Barn Doors Repair Questions
What types of barn door repairs are commonly needed? Repairs often include fixing misaligned tracks, replacing damaged panels, and addressing hardware issues to ensure smooth operation.
Can barn doors be repaired if they are off-track? Yes, misaligned or off-track barn doors can typically be realigned or reinstalled to restore proper function.
What causes barn doors to become difficult to open or close? Issues such as worn rollers, loose hardware, or warped door panels can make barn doors hard to operate.
Is it possible to repair barn doors without replacing the entire door? Many repairs focus on hardware, rollers, or panels, allowing for restoration without full replacement of the door.
